Title:
SLURRY COMPOSITION, CERAMIC GREEN SHEET AND COATED SHEET

Abstract:
The purposes of the present invention are: to provide a slurry composition which is capable of suppressing the occurrence of cracks after drying, while exhibiting high dispersibility and storage stability at the same time, and a ceramic green sheet and a coated sheet, each of which is produced using this slurry composition; to provide a slurry composition which enables the achievement of a ceramic green sheet that exhibits excellent adhesiveness when compression bonded in cases where the ceramic green sheet or a coated sheet is produced using this slurry composition; to provide a ceramic green sheet or a coated sheet, which is not susceptible to delamination in cases where a fired body is produced by laminating the sheets; and to provide a slurry composition which is capable of suppressing the occurrence of cracks after drying of the slurry composition. The present invention relates to a slurry composition which contains a binder resin (A) that has a hydroxyl group in each molecule, an organic compound (B) represented by general formula (1), an organic solvent (C) and an inorganic compound (D), and wherein the difference between the solubility parameter of the binder resin (A) and the solubility parameter of the organic compound (B), namely |∆SP| is 2.1 (J/cm3)1/2 or less.
